Abortion: Precious Life calls for appeal in case of woman who took drugs to end pregnancy
An anti-abortion group has said it has called for the case of a woman given a suspended prison sentence after buying drugs online to terminate pregnancy to be brought to the appeals court.
Precious Life described the sentence as "very lenient".
On Monday, Belfast Crown Court heard the 21-year old woman could not afford to travel to England for a termination.
...
Unlike the rest of the UK, abortion is only permitted in Northern Ireland if a woman's life is at risk or there is a permanent or serious risk to her mental or physical health.
